Callaway FT-I Squareway

The Callaway FT-i Squareway is easy to align and delivers high, arcing shots. Better players may find it hard to shape but the accuracy should make up for that.

The square design of the Callaway FT-i Squareway fairway wood allows weight to be moved into the corners for a more stable performance through impact. The Squareway should suit golfers who are searching for greater accuracy and like the square-shaped look.
